Australian Internet Usage Survey: method 2023
The Australian Internet Usage Survey (AIUS) uses a sequential mixed-mode design. An online self-completion survey is offered first, with a hard copy option initiated during a second phase of data collection.

Understanding and preventing internet-facilitated radicalisation
This paper reviews available research on how the internet facilitates radicalisation and measures to prevent it. It briefly canvasses evidence on the extent to which the internet contributes to radicalisation broadly, and who is most susceptible to its influence, before delving further into the mechanisms underpinning the relationship between the internet and violent extremism.
